12cR2 CRS logged solaris user error

Hallo,

every time a issue a

# crsctl start crs

on Oracle 12cR2 RAC over an Oracle Solaris 11.3 SPARC, the os system log shows:

Xxx  x xx:xx:xx xxxxxxxxx root: [ID 702911 user.error] exec /grid/perl/bin/perl -I/grid/perl/lib /grid/bin/crswrapexece.pl /grid/crs/install/s_crsconfig_xxxxxxxxxx_env.txt /grid/bin/ohasd.bin "reboot"

even if everything goes fine and crs stack gets up fine as well as databases.

How come is it logged as an user.error ?

Is there a way to ger rid of it ?
